IBS does not lead to inflammatory bowel diseases. Not ever. There is no connection, no link, IBS and IBD have literally nothing in common in terms of origin and underlying pathology.

And trying to "wean your body off fiber" makes about as much sense as weaning your body off of any other fundamental nutrient. In other words, it makes no sense whatsoever.
